The Obama Family's Christmas Traditions: Greeting Cards, Social Media Posts, and Gift-Giving
The Obama family is known for their tradition of sending out a large number of Christmas cards each year. Michelle Obama shared that they send over 100,000 cards to family, friends, business associates, and foundation contacts. This revelation was made during her appearance on Jimmy Kimmel Live! The Obamas, including Michelle, Barack, and their daughters Malia and Sasha, also share sentimental posts on social media to mark the Christmas holiday annually. Last year, Barack posted a family photo on Instagram, while Michelle shared a picture of their dog, Sunny.
In addition to sending out holiday greetings, Barack Obama also creates year-end lists featuring his favorite movies, TV shows, music, and books. Some of his favorites from 2024 included songs by Beyoncé, Kendrick Lamar, and Billie Eilish, as well as movies like Conclave, Anora, and Dune: Part Two. Michelle Obama revealed on Jimmy Kimmel Live! that she is the one who orchestrates the Obama family's gift-giving at Christmas. She mentioned that everyone in the family receives a gift, and she is the mastermind behind the process. When asked if Barack receives good gifts, Michelle confirmed that he does and mentioned that their stylist, Meredith Koop, helps with the gift selection.
